t66 what kinda power?
ok im wondering what kinda power im looking at getting out of a t66 setup? im planing on getting a sr5 block and porting it LARGE street port. i have a standalone (micritech) already. i want a good and safe 300 hp i figure alonge the lines of 1000 or 1200cc primes and 1200-1600 cc 2nds and ill have plenty of fuel to feed the motor. i was planing on getting ato4 but was told id be running it hard to get the 300 i want and was told to get a larger turbo. im not wanting to get a HUGE turbo and start getting lots of lag but i do want to have a turbo im not doging out to get the #'s i want.
#3
Mad Man
Basicly, you are looking at the wrong turbo. A TO4 in almost any rotary sized iteration will make 300-350rwhp easily(.70cover, .96 ptrim on a cast mani). A T66 is a 20-30psi, 450-600rwhp turbo done right.

A TO4E would do the job nicely! I'm putting together a T66 setup with a half bp motor and 18-20 psi. I'm expecting right around the 500rwhp mark. So if you're looking for only 300rwhp, a T04E would do the job PERFECTLY. Just my take on things though. Laterz.
